**Runbook: LoomLock laundry-locker access flow**

Reviewer notes: access flow is QR scan → token validation → locker latch release. Validation must hit the Drennan auth service, never the local cache, for first opens. Latch timeout is 8s, non-configurable. Reject any patch that bypasses the audit write. Failure path re-locks and logs. Verify the deployed build matches the token below.

pipeline stamp: htk9_ce63042d9

## Deploying the Gatewick Proctor Queue

Deploys are pretty painless: push to main, wait for the pipeline, then watch the queue drain dashboard for five minutes. If candidates pile up mid-exam, roll back first and ask questions later — the queue replays safely. Everything the workers care about lives in one config block, shown here for reference.

settings of bafof-yagef:
JOROX_PIN=8740
JOROX_TENANT=pelox
JOROX_METRICS_HOST=metrics.jorox.qorvelworks.internal
JOROX_SEAL=seal_c78f63c1
JOROX_STANDBY_TEAM=norax

## Changelog — v2.8.1

Renamed setting: PRICEX_AB_KEY is now PRICEX_EXPERIMENT_SECRET, used by the Tollgren ticket-pricing experiment service to sign variant-assignment payloads. The old name is deprecated and will stop being read in v2.9.0. Rotation was performed at rename time, so old values are invalid. Update your env file by removing the old entry and appending the new assignment immediately after this note:

secret setting of kaguf-bawif: ARCHIVE_KEY3=ebb

# Env file for the Brindlemap address autocomplete widget.
# Read carefully before editing: values here are loaded at build time,
# so any change requires a full redeploy of the widget bundle.
# The suggestions endpoint, cache TTL, and locale list are set further down.
# The widget cannot fetch suggestions without a valid lookup credential,
# and requests will silently return empty results if it is missing.
# That credential is set on the line immediately below.

vault entry, kafog-yahop: COURIER_KEY8=0faa53ae